Integration Solution Designer- Extensibility Dev3+ Months ContractReston, VA (100% Remote)Duties:- As an Integration Solution Designer, you will lead integration development projects, supporting the business capabilities that provide core functionality in running the client’s higher education businesses.
- The Integration Solution Designers will configure and customize integration middleware, data attributes for business domains, and connectors to enable data exchange between diverse systems.
- You will analyse business requirements and ensure implemented integrations are effectively integrated into the modernization technology ecosystem.
- You will ensure that the technology solutions delivered are aligned with enterprise strategies and adhere to target reference architectures by applying sound architectural principles & best practices and following client’s IT governance processes and guidelines. You should be able to identify and address potential bottlenecks, performance issues, and data conflicts during the integration process.
- You will collect data attributes and transformation rules to ensure data consistency and accuracy while moving information between different systems.
- This role is critical as we build our next-generation services and capabilities to mature our solution on the cloud.
- This role will assist our key technology strategy while directly responsible for service architecture, which integrates several of our products/solutions across the enterprise.
- This is a high-impact and high-visibility opportunity to bring your expertise and make a difference.
Skills:- 5+ years of experience in designing, developing, and implementing integration solutions for complex Student, Financial Aid, Finance and/or HR systems (ideally ERP-specific), including conducting integration impact assessments, creating integration designs (both high-level and detailed), defining testing approaches for integration and planning and execution for modernization systems.
- 5+ years experience in web service development and integration patterns using REST or SOAP, JMS messaging, Request/Reply, and Publish /Subscriber models.
- 2+ Complex integration architecture and design experience with working experience and knowledge on at least one ESB integration platform (MuleSoft ESB, Oracle SOA/OSB, IBM Websphere ESB, Microsoft Biztalk).
- Exposure to API-based integration strategies for integrations is a must
- Good SOA architecture understanding.
- Hands-on experience designing and developing inbound and outbound integration interfaces with API Web services (REST and SOAP service development skills)
- Experience in managing integration projects, understanding the client ecosystems and delivering the assessment integration requirements and managing the technical implementation and delivery for the project executions
- Strong and broad exposure to integration middleware platforms and tools like AWS, Boomi, MuleSoft, or similar solutions enterprise integration tools
- Experience in large-scale Technology Change Programs through delivery and transition to business-as-usual arrangements
- Knowledge and experience with XML-related technologies (XML, XSD etc)
- Knowledge and experience in HTTP, REST, SOAP, JSON technologies.
- Knowledge and experience of bases (SQL)
- Knowledge and experience with Software Version Control systems: GIT, SVN etc.
- Strong understanding of system architecture principles and the ability to design scalable and efficient integration solutions that align with the overall IT infrastructure
- Strong knowledge of various integration technologies, platforms, and tools, including a deep understanding of integration patterns, APIs, ETL (Extract, Transform, Load) processes, middleware, and collect data attributes for the exchange of business domain objects.
- Schedule and conduct meetings with customer representatives to understand their requirements and accurately capture them for use in downstream phases of the software development life cycle.
- Be able to identify appropriate technologies for the solution given the constraints of the client environment.
- Proficiency in integrating ERP systems with other enterprise applications, databases, and other third-party systems to ensure seamless data exchange.
- Sound analytical and problem-solving skills to address complex challenges related to ERP architecture and system integration.
- Prepare concise technical documents that accurately describe project requirements and specifications for delivery.
- Work with a dynamic team of developers and other peers to Architect, build, and test the processes according to the prepared specifications.
- Technical knowledge of higher education domain objects (ideally ERP-specific) is preferred.
- Strong end-to-end team and project skills, including experience in Waterfall and Agile delivery methods and techniques (e.g., daily stand-ups, prototyping, sprints), detailed ‘hands on’ day-to-day management of workstreams, as well as working within large teams to drive highly strategic and transformational initiatives within complex organizational environments.
- Excellent planning, organizational, and time management skills and solid attention to detail.
- Excellent written and oral communication skills, including the ability to prepare and deliver detailed reports, briefings, and presentations to various audiences and a strong ability to converse with stakeholders at all levels of an organizational hierarchy.
Education:- Bachelor’s qualification in computer science / Information Technology / Software Engineering or equivalent (and/or extensive relevant experience).
